**Action item (PM-14, Velvetbox seat-map outage):** So, quick recap for security review — the Stagelight renderer was fetching seat-hold state over an unauthenticated internal endpoint, which is how the scraper enumerated held seats during the Orpheline Hall presale. Fix is to move seat-hold reads behind the gateway token check and rotate the renderer's service credential. Marek owns this, due end of sprint. Please sanity-check the auth model before we close it out. The full threat notes live on the internal page here:

runbook for badug-kadup: https://confluence.zemvarlabs.internal/projects/browse/display/projects/bd1b

**Changelog — Tollgate payment retries**

Default change: Tollgate now generates idempotency keys automatically for every payment retry, rather than only when the client supplies one. This closes the duplicate-charge window we discussed two syncs ago. Clients passing their own keys are unaffected. Retry backoff defaults were also tightened. The new default configuration is as follows.

deployment values, hahaf-fahop:
zorwyn:
  log_level: debug
  metrics_host: metrics.zorwyn.tolvaqlabs.internal
  pool_size: 8

## Break-Glass Access: Quillstream Compaction Service

Plugin authors integrating with Quillstream's log compaction layer normally never touch compactor state directly. If a compaction stall corrupts segment offsets and the admin API is unreachable, break-glass access lets you halt the compactor and replay from the last clean checkpoint. Use this only after confirming the stall with the Quillstream on-call rotation, and record every action taken. To unlock the break-glass console, enter the recovery passphrase exactly as shown below.

unlock words, yawig-kagef: gordor-holvan-ulaael-pramir-ulaiel-tamdor

## Step 7: Recalibrate the dispatch model

After upgrading Ostrell to 4.2, the elevator-dispatch simulator must be restarted with the new car-assignment weights, or wait-time predictions will drift badly during peak scenarios. Verify the scenario database migrated cleanly before proceeding. Once confirmed, restart the simulator using the configuration values shown below.

deployment values, yadug-bawif:
[framir]
team = pelox
access_code = ac_a38ab2
owner = tamion.julael
host = framir.tolvaqlabs.test
port = 11211
peer = tammir.zemvargrid.local
salt = 2215ef03
pin = 1541